What is RBL file?

RBL is a file extension commonly associated with RegexBuddy Library files. RegexBuddy Library specification was created by Just Great Software Co. Ltd.. RBL files are supported by software applications available for devices running Windows. Files with RBL extension are categorized as Misc Files files. The Misc Files subset comprises 6033 various file formats. The most popular software that supports RBL files is RegexBuddy. Software named RegexBuddy was created by Just Great Software Co. Ltd.. Associate software with RBL file on Windows

Selecting the first-choice application in Windows

  • Clicking the RBL with right mouse button will bring a menu from which you should select the Open with option
  • Click Choose another app and then select More apps option
  • The last step is to select Look for another app on this PC option supply the directory path to the folder where RegexBuddy is installed. Now all that is left is to confirm your choice by selecting Always use this app to open RBL files and clicking OK.
Associate software with RBL file on Mac

Selecting the first-choice application in Mac OS

  • By clicking right mouse button on the selected RBL file open the file menu and choose Information
  • Proceed to the Open with section. If its closed, click the title to access available options
  • Select the appropriate software and save your settings by clicking Change all
  • A message window should appear informing that This change will be applied to all files with RBL extension. By clicking Continue you confirm your selection.
